If a patient cannot avoid smoking for 4 weeks before rhinoplasty, I would not consider him or her for surgery at that time, as nicotine is a powerful vasoconstrictor (squeezes arteries) and limits blood flow, which could lead to loss of skin, delayed healing, and other problems that are inexcusable in elective surgery.
